The motor will act like a vacuum cleaner motor when you block airflow. It’ll speed up a little because there’s a reduced load. WebWhat your looking to do is create a ratio between the motor and the drum. Example: A 50:1 ratio would mean the one side spins 50 times to the other side making one revolution. In your case you might want to consider a slower motor as it would be much easier to work with. 14 rpm is pretty slow.

WebMar 8, 2024 · Indeed, it might have a built in speed controller, but I am guessing not. An easy experiment, if it is a brush-type motor, is to try running it on 12 volts DC. You can try that first off a car battery, and if the speed is OK then one of those 12 volt or 19 volt power supplies from a resale shop can drive it and you are all set.
